Biography

Frederick Arthur Crisp was born on 27 June 1851 in Walworth, Surrey, England, the eldest son of Sarah Steedman and Frederick Augustus Crisp.[1][2][3][4][5][6]

He was a family historian and published many texts of genealogical interest at his private press in London.[1] These texts included:

  • Fragmenta Genealogica (volume 1 published in 1889)
  • Visitations of England and Wales
  • The Parish Registers of Pakenham, Suffolk (1888)

He married Gertrude South on 21 October 1880. [7] They had six daughters:

At the time of the 1901 England Census, Frederick and his family were living at Grove Park, Camberwell, London.[5] Frederick was employed as a patent medicine vendor.[5]

Frederick died on 25 April 1922.[1][2] His remains were interred at All Saints Churchyard in Little Wenham, Suffolk, England.[2] He is commemorated with a stained glass window in St John's Church, Farncombe, Surrey.
